At least four civilians were killed Friday by Syrian security forces in the restive cities of Homs and Hama, opposition activists reported.
"Four people, including a 10-year-old girl, were killed when Syrian security forces fired on protesters following the Friday noon prayers," Ashraf Omar, an activist from Homs, told dpa.
Meanwhile, Syrian security forces cracked down on Hama and the eastern city of Deir al-Zour hunting for army deserters, according to Omar. "Fifty people have been arrested so far," he said.
